Skip to main content
Log in
Čeština (cs)
English (en)
Documentation
Čeština (cs)
English (en)
Optimal and Robust Control
B3M35ORR + BE3M35ORR + BE3M35ORC
Home
Courses
BE3M35ORR, B3M35ORR, BE3M35ORC - B212
16 May - 22 May
Software
This course is part of an already archived semester and is therefore read-only.
Software
Completion requirements
Matlab
CVX
Yalmip
Mosek
Sedumi
SDPT3
...
Julia
Convex
JuMP
...
Python
cvxpy
...
Last modified: Tuesday, 18 May 2021, 6:11 PM
◄ M-files for the lecture
Jump to...
Jump to...
News
Annotation
Overall learning goals
Link to the official timetable
Language of the course
Organization of the course
Grading rules, how to pass the course
Literature for the course
Software used in the course
Related courses at other universities
Semestral projects
Implementation of a high-performance QP solver for MPC applications
Model predictive control for SK80 wheeled bipedal robot
Control for a laboratory 3DOF helicopter
Active suspension
Handle-like robot
Distillation column
Advanced control design for Tokamak
Dual-stage inertial stabilization
Discussion forum for lectures, exercises, problems, ...
Learning goals
Assigned reading, recommended further reading
Software
Video lectures
Texts from the videos
Optimization CHEATSHEET
Online quiz #1
Examples and problems
M-files and other code used in the "lecture"
Matlab files for the exercises
Solutions for the exercises given in the seminar
Homework problem assignment #1
Learning goals
Assigned reading, recommended further reading
Lecture notes #2
Lecture slides #2
Online quiz #2
Examples and problems
M-files for the lecture
Julia files for the lecture
M-files for the exercises
Solutions for the exercises given in the seminar
Homework problem assignment #2
Learning goals
Assigned reading, recommended further reading
Lecture notes #3
Video lectures
Texts for the videos
Software
Online quiz #3
M-files for the lecture
Julia files for the lecture
Homework problem assignment #3
M-file for the exercises
Solutions for the exercises given in the seminar
Learning goals
Assigned reading, recommended further reading
Lecture notes #4
Video lectures
Texts for the videos
Discrete-time optimal control on a fixed horizon - indirect approach - CHEATSHEET
Online quiz #4
M-files for the lecture
Julia files for the lecture
Homework problem assignment #4
M-files for the exercises
Learning goals
Assigned reading, recommended further reading
Lecture notes #5
Video-lectures
Online quiz #5
Julia files for the lecture
Homework problem assignment #5
M-files for the exercises
Solutions for the exercises given in the seminar
Learning goals
Assigned reading, recommended further reading
Software
Handwritten lecture notes - temporary
Lecture notes #6
Cheatsheet
Online quiz #6
Julia files for the lecture
M-files for the lecture
Homework problem assignment #6
Solution of Homework problem assignment #6
M-files for the exercise
M-files for the exercise - solution
Learning goals
Assigned reading, recommended further reading
Video-lectures
Lecture notes #7
Online quiz #7
M-files for the exercise
M-files for the exercise - solution
Homework problem assignment #7
Learning goals
Assigned reading, recommended further reading
M-files and other code used in the "lecture"
Software tools for numerical optimal control
Online quiz #8
M-files for the lab session
M-files for the lab session - solution
Homework problem assignment #8
Learning goals
Assigned reading, recommended further reading
Lecture slides (2x2 handouts)
Video-lectures
M-files and Simulink models for the lecture
Online quiz #9
Matlab files for the seminar
Learning goals
Assigned reading, recommended further reading
Lecture slides (2x2 handouts)
M-files and Simulink models for the lecture
Online quiz #10
Homework problem assignment #1 - Retest
Homework problem assignment #2 - Retest
Homework problem assignment #3 - Retest
Homework problem assignment #4 - Retest
Homework problem assignment #5 - Retest
Homework problem assignment #6 - Retest
Homework problem assignment #7 - Retest
Homework problem assignment #8 - Retest
Learning goals
Assigned reading, recommended further reading
Lecture slides (2x2 handouts)
M-files and Simulink models for the lecture
Online quiz #11
Matlab files for the seminar
Solutions of the exercises given in the seminar
Homework problem assignment #11
Learning goals
Assigned reading, recommended further reading
Lecture slides
M-files and Simulink models for the lecture
Exercises and examples
The first three chapters of Skogestad's book.
Learning goals
Assigned reading, recommended further reading
Lecture slides
M-files and Simulink models for the lecture
Software and benchmarks
Semestral Project
Assigned reading, recommended further reading
Learning goals
Lecture slides
M-files for the lecture